Start with the Basics
Before diving into a full-blown painting project, take a step back and evaluate what needs attention. The first thing to tackle is any preparation that might be required. Home exterior surfaces have likely been through a lot—wind, rain, snow, and sun all take their toll. Power washing quickly and effectively removes built-up dirt, grime, and mildew that can accumulate on siding, fences, or decks. Starting with a clean surface ensures that a new coat of paint will adhere correctly and last longer.
Once the surfaces are prepped, examine any areas that may need repair. Small cracks, chips, or holes in the siding or trim can detract from the overall look of the paint job. Fill in any imperfections, and don't skip this crucial step. A smooth, even surface will provide a much more professional finish when the paint is applied.
Bold Choices for a Bold Look
Now, for the fun part—choosing the color. The paint chosen has the potential to completely change the vibe of the home. Whether leaning toward a classic look with neutral shades or something more daring with bold hues, the chosen color will immediately impact. A well-chosen color can bring out a home's unique features, highlight the architectural details, and even increase curb appeal.
When picking a shade, consider the surrounding environment. A bright, bold color might pop against a lush green lawn or colorful garden, while muted tones like greys and beiges can provide a timeless, sophisticated look. Regardless of the color choice, make sure the color complements the rest of the home's style and fits the overall aesthetic of the neighborhood. Be Patient, Take the Time
Painting a home's exterior doesn't need to be rushed. Sure, finishing the job in one weekend might be tempting, but quality work takes time. By breaking up the project into manageable sections, each part can be given the attention it deserves. Whether the trim is tackled in one day and the fence the next, pacing the job will result in a smoother finish.
Remember, good preparation is key. If working with multiple layers of old paint, take the time to sand down any rough spots. This step helps the new paint adhere and gives a flawless finish.
